Phenomenology of vector-meson electroproduction on spinless targets

Abstract

Advantages of the amplitude method for the vector-meson-production description in respect of the spin-density-matrix-element (SDME) method are discussed. It is shown that for any nonzero amplitudes the angular distribution of final particles is non-negative. The exact formula for R = d σLd t/d σTd t in terms of the SDMEs for spinless targets and the new approximate formula for nucleons are presented.
